Identifying Risk Factors:

Several elements add to the susceptibility of both drivers and passengers in ride-hailing vehicles. The inherent nature of the platform, which often involves strangers in close proximity, increases the potential for dangerous situations. Aspects such as nighttime trips, intoxicated passengers, lack of adequate background checks, and the absence of in-vehicle security features can further aggravate the risks. It is essential to recognize these factors and implement proactive measures to mitigate them.

Enhanced Safety Measures:

Rideshare companies have a responsibility to prioritize the security of their drivers and passengers. They should regularly review and enhance safety measures to combat sexual assault and violence. Some important precautionary steps include:

a) Rigorous background checks: In-depth background checks should be performed on those providing the rides to identify any prior criminal history or red flags.

b) Identity verification: Employing robust identification processes, such as verifying users' identities through ID authentication or biometric data, can help reduce the likelihood of fraudulent use to the platform.

c) In-app safety features: Both leading rideshare providers have implemented safety features, such as panic buttons, live location tracking, and two-way ratings, to enhance responsibility and enable swift responses to potential emergencies.

d) Education and training: Providing thorough training programs to users, covering safety awareness, conflict de-escalation, and how to report incidents, is vital. Promoting a climate of zero tolerance for assault and violence within the ridesharing community is critical.

Engaged Law Enforcement Involvement:

Law enforcement authorities play a critical role in combating assault and violence within the ride-hailing sector. They should work closely together with ridesharing companies to develop efficient strategies to tackle and respond to such crimes. Some key steps for law enforcement authorities include:

a) Improved reporting mechanisms: Establishing streamlined reporting channels and ensuring privacy for those affected can promote more reporting and facilitate enforcement efforts.

b) Partnerships and information exchange: Sharing relevant information between law enforcement and ridesharing companies can assist in detecting recurrent perpetrators and strengthening preventive measures.

c) Training and education: Conducting educational workshops for law enforcement personnel to better understand the unique challenges of assault and violence in the ridesharing sector can enhance their ability to address effectively.
